Direct Trade
From the volcanic slopes of Prau, Indonesia, this exceptional Typica lot is cultivated by producer Reza Nurullah at 1300 meters and processed using the experimental Mosto Natural method—fermenting the cherries with fruit must to intensify its profile.
In the cup, expect vivid guava, coffee blossom, and mastic, layered with elegant florals and a juicy tropical acidity. Sweetness shines through with minimal bitterness, creating a bright, clean, and expressive pour-over experience.
A wild yet refined coffee that truly stands out on the cupping table.
